Transaction f76e5a3543d723d8c9ec07db314d3854b41cef366a3403535a4bf6250dee620c

1 Input
2 Outputs
  • f76e5a3543d723d8c9ec07db314d3854b41cef366a3403535a4bf6250dee620c:0
  • value  1026786417
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• f76e5a3543d723d8c9ec07db314d3854b41cef366a3403535a4bf6250dee620c:1
  • value  66285154
    address  3PQ4dn17Ev92WnMZdh7vA3JGQUEwgurcPk